Detached Two Bedroom Cottage at La Bourg
Located in the heart of La Bourge and just a short stroll from the beach, this immaculate two-bedroom detached cottage sits on a generous plot.
The ground floor features a charming, cottage-style kitchen complete with a larder for additional storage, leading into a separate dining room. The inviting sitting room, centred around an electric fireplace, enhances the cosy cottage ambience. With high ceilings and an abundance of natural light throughout, the home feels bright, airy, and spacious.
Upstairs, there are two well-proportioned double bedrooms, one with built-in wardrobes and drawers, along with a family bathroom.
Outside, the property benefits from ample parking for up to four cars and a large garden shed.
It offers excellent local amenities and convenient transport links, ideally positioned close to the Co-Op and the No. 1 bus stop.
Bright, beautifully presented, and move-in ready, this delightful home perfectly blends comfort and convenience in a highly sought-after location.
